Tribunal declares re-run for Ethiope West Constituency

Delta State National and State Houses of Assembly Election Petition Tribunal sitting in Asaba on Sunday ordered a re-run election for Ethiope West Constituency seat in the State House of Assembly.

While Pastor Christian Onogba contested the March 18 election on the banner of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Blessing Achoja ran on the platform of the All Progressives Congress (APC).

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) in the election declared Achoja as the winner.

The three-man tribunal panel headed by Hon Justice W. I. Kpochi as chairman has Hon Justice Chinedu V. C. Ezeugwu and Hon Justice Safiya B. Umar, as members.

The tribunal in its ruling ordered the nation’s electoral umpire to within 90 days conduct a re-run election in 39 units where the election was cancelled across Ward 1, 2, 6, 7 and 8 in Ethiope Local Government Area.

Meanwhile, NewsNet Nigeria gathered that the Asaba residence of Onogba presently has erupted in jubilation as supporters and other stakeholders thronged his residence to celebrate the tribunal’s victory with him.

A PDP stalwart in Delta State who craved anonymity disclosed to this medium that the 39 units where the re-run would be conducted are the party’s strongholds in Mosogar and Oghara.

Pastor Christian Onogba is a two-time member of the Delta State Executive Council in charge of the Brace Commission during the administration of former Governor Emmanuel Uduaghan and later superintended the Ministry of Environment in the first tenure of immediate past Governor of Delta State, Dr Ifeanyi Okowa.
